Trails and Landscape
The Boucle de Peypensou passes through the Forêt du Landais and along the Ironzeau and its tributaries. The Boucle du Cluzeau also runs through the Forêt du Landais to Bosset.
The Boucle de Biorne is a 5.6 km circular trail starting in Lunas. It is classified as very easy on foot and takes 1 hour and 50 minutes; its route runs from east to west through the wooded Ironzeau valley.
The Ironzeau is a 6.47 km long natural, non-navigable watercourse that flows into the Eyraud in Lunas.
Culture and History
On the Boucle de Biorne, visitors can discover the Neo-Gothic Church of Saint-Jean-Baptise in Lunas. It was built after a fire destroyed the former wooden church. The presence of Benedictine monks in Lunas is also documented for the 12th century.
Agriculture and Tastings
The Ferme de Biorne in Lunas has an animal park with ducks, geese, sheep, pigs and chickens. It also offers individual, free tasting visits lasting an average of 45 minutes. The products on offer include foie gras, rillettes, pâté, poultry gizzards and duck confit.
Events
The Beau C'est Festival is an annual summer performing arts event held in Bosset and Lunas. It offers a family-oriented, sociable programme that is accessible to everyone.
